Função FsRtlNotifyInitializeSync (ntifs.h)

A rotina FsRtlNotifyInitializeSync aloca e inicializa um objeto de sincronização para uma lista de notificação.

Sintaxe

void FsRtlNotifyInitializeSync(
  [in] PNOTIFY_SYNC *NotifySync
);

Parâmetros

[in] NotifySync

Um ponteiro para um local no qual retornar um ponteiro para o objeto de sincronização opaco.

Retornar valor

Nenhum

Comentários

O sistema aloca o objeto de sincronização do pool nãopagado. Se ocorrer uma falha de alocação de pool, FsRtlNotifyInitializeSync gerará uma exceção STATUS_INSUFFICIENT_RESOURCES. Para obter controle se essa falha de alocação de pool ocorrer, o driver deverá encapsular a chamada para FsRtlNotifyInitializeSync em uma instrução try-except ou try-finally .

Cada chamada bem-sucedida para FsRtlNotifyInitializeSync deve ser correspondida por uma chamada subsequente para FsRtlNotifyUninitializeSync.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 2000
Plataforma de Destino Universal
Cabeçalho ntifs.h (inclua FltKernel.h, Ntifs.h)
Biblioteca NtosKrnl.lib
DLL NtosKrnl.exe
IRQL <= APC_LEVEL

Confira também

FsRtlNotifyUninitializeSync